Quote of movie "Gandhi" made in 1982: Government Advocate:general Dyer, Is It Correct...

Government advocate: General Dyer, is it correct that you ordered your troops to fire at the thickest part of the crowd?

Gen. Dyer: [righteous tone] That is correct.
Government advocate: One thousand five hundred and sixteen casualties with one thousand six hundred and fifty bullets.
Gen.

Dyer: My intention was to inflict a lesson that would have an impact throughout all India.
Indian barrister: General, had you been able to take in the armored car, would you have opened fire with the machine gun?

Gen. Dyer: I think, probably - yes.

Lord Hunter: General, did you realzie there were children, and women, in the crowd?

Gen. Dyer: I did.
Government advocate: But that was irerlevant to the point you were making?




Government advocate: Could I ask you what provision you made for the wounded?


Gen. Dyer: I was ready to help any who applied.
Government advocate: General, how does a child shot with a 303 Enifeld "apply" for help?
